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85650895 213 47286039584 3141853622
1608227 0729018126 4991430704
1608227 0729018126 4991430704
96839 11 3207131 899508 593
All about undefined
Interested in learning more?
1608227 0729018126 4991430704
96839 11 3207131 899508 593
See more
84407606410 1233411 638
555034 553076 4513241734 281932
See more
45396457 4481
40774521 2526 7638
See more